/**
 * A synchronization context used to coordinate concurrent access to artifacts or metadatas. The typical usage of a
 * synchronization context looks like this:
 * 
 * 
 * SyncContext syncContext = repositorySystem.newSyncContext( ... );
 * try {
 *     syncContext.acquire( artifacts, metadatas );
 *     // work with the artifacts and metadatas
 * } finally {
 *     syncContext.close();
 * }
 * 
* * Within one thread, synchronization contexts may be nested which can naturally happen in a hierarchy of method calls. * The nested synchronization contexts may also acquire overlapping sets of artifacts/metadatas as long as the following * conditions are met. If the outer-most context holding a particular resource is exclusive, that resource can be * reacquired in any nested context. If however the outer-most context is shared, the resource may only be reacquired by * nested contexts if these are also shared. *

* A synchronization context is meant to be utilized by only one thread and as such is not thread-safe. *

* Note that the level of actual synchronization is subject to the implementation and might range from OS-wide to none. * * @see RepositorySystem#newSyncContext(RepositorySystemSession, boolean) */ public interface SyncContext extends Closeable { /** * Acquires synchronized access to the specified artifacts and metadatas. The invocation will potentially block * until all requested resources can be acquired by the calling thread. Acquiring resources that are already * acquired by this synchronization context has no effect. Please also see the class-level documentation for * information regarding reentrancy. The method may be invoked multiple times on a synchronization context until all * desired resources have been acquired. * * @param artifacts The artifacts to acquire, may be {@code null} or empty if none. * @param metadatas The metadatas to acquire, may be {@code null} or empty if none. */ void acquire( Collection artifacts, Collection metadatas ); /** * Releases all previously acquired artifacts/metadatas. If no resources have been acquired before or if this * synchronization context has already been closed, this method does nothing. */ void close(); }
